                  If you have different internal servers but only one external name: They can't all have the same name.
                  If that is a requirement then you will have to go the NAT reflection way.

                  I for myself would set it up a like this:
                  teamspeak.domain.com
                  mail.domain.com
                  gallery.domain.com
                  etc.
                  From external they resolve all to the same ip (your WAN).
                  Internally they would all resolve to their respective server.

                  The easiest way to achieve this: make sure all your clients use the pfSense as DNS-server.
                  Go to "Services: DNS forwarder"
                  Add in the "Host Overrides" list below your domains you want to redirect locally.

                  (example from my home-setup:
                  m may.nu  10.0.8.210
                  webserver m.may.nu  10.0.8.210
                  c  m.may.nu  10.0.8.220
                  owncloud  m.may.nu  10.0.8.220
                  files  m.may.nu  10.0.8.230

                      Split DNS gives you direct wire speed access to your internal servers (I'm guessing your internal network is running a minimum 100 Mb links but your WAN connection is 10Mb). Makes trouble shooting connections much easier and causes less load on the firewall(s)
                      Reflection is fine for home use or small offices but is not really a goer for anything over a dozen users. I you have an internal DNS server it's just a case of altering your IP from the WAN address to the internal addresses.

                      I've no idea how you've got your external DNS setup but all you need to do is give all of them the external WAN IP which is what I assume you have now and let the different port based NATs sort out which server gets it.
